| Autor |
Mensagem |
![[Post New]](/templates/default/images/icon_minipost_new.gif) 29/11/2008 07:34:34
|
hugleo
Thread.start()
Membro desde: 16/02/2007 20:21:19
Mensagens: 29
Offline
|
Possuo um componente de acesso aos dados com as seguintes características:
Dados
Dados.DCliente.nome
Dados.DCliente.endereço
Dados.DCliente.cpf
E tenho que apresentar isso em uma tela de cadastro.
Quais são as classes que eu tenho que criar para uma boa modelagem?
Os dados do cliente já estão em Dados.DCliente.nome, etc.
Crio ainda a Classe Cliente, com getNome, getEndereco, etc? Mesmo tendo Dados.DCliente.nome, etc?
E cadastro?
Crio tipo:
Cadastro.campoTextoNome = cliente.getNome()?
Cadastro.show();
|
|
|
 |
|
|
![[Post New]](/templates/default/images/icon_minipost_new.gif) 30/11/2008 11:16:16
|
Andre Brito
JWizard
Membro desde: 21/07/2007 17:44:31
Mensagens: 2485
Localização: Paraná
Offline
|
Não entendi direito a sua pergunta, mas pelo que pude ver, você está criando variáveis public. Estou errado?
Bom, acredito que um bom padrão a ser usado é o MVC. Dê uma procurada que tem bastante coisa sobre isso.
Abraço.
|
Como organizar o GUJ.
Meu Twitter.
Meu blog.
Future proofing means making code easy to change, not trying to anticipate every possible way your code might need to change. |
|
|
 |
![[Post New]](/templates/default/images/icon_minipost_new.gif) 30/11/2008 12:13:18
|
hugleo
Thread.start()
Membro desde: 16/02/2007 20:21:19
Mensagens: 29
Offline
|
Isso
publics e globais.
|
|
|
 |
![[Post New]](/templates/default/images/icon_minipost_new.gif) 01/12/2008 06:58:28
|
Andre Brito
JWizard
Membro desde: 21/07/2007 17:44:31
Mensagens: 2485
Localização: Paraná
Offline
|
Então,
Criar variáveis public e globais não é uma boa prática de programação.
|
Como organizar o GUJ.
Meu Twitter.
Meu blog.
Future proofing means making code easy to change, not trying to anticipate every possible way your code might need to change. |
|
|
 |
|
|